Research Scientists at IBM drive the leading edge of quantum computing technologies with the industry’s most advanced hardware and software. Join an elite team of engineers and scientists building a path towards scalable fault tolerant quantum computation.
Your Role And Responsibilities
A successful candidate will
- Identify feasible quantum algorithms and application areas for early fault tolerant quantum devices, Benchmark resource requirements depending on problem parameters, implementation details, and circuit synthesis strategies, and develop and study compiler optimizations for quantum circuits targeting fault tolerant architectures.
Doctorate Degree
Required Technical And Professional Expertise
- Doctorate degree in Engineering, Physics, or Computer Science, or related software experience
- Experience with quantum algorithm design and analysis, quantum compiler or computer architecture, or related topics in quantum computation
- Familiarity with programming languages for scientific computing (Python, or equivalent)
- Familiarity with programming languages for high-performance computing (Rust, C , or equivalent)
- Experience with large-scale software engineering projects involving multiple contributors and programming languages.
